We tend to assume that our map of the intellectual disciplines is valid cross-culturally. G. E. R. Lloyd challenges this in relation to eight main areas of human endeavour, namely philosophy, mathematics, history, medicine, art, law, religion, and science, by examining how the disciplines were conceived and developed in different times and places.

Sir Geoffrey Lloyd is Emeritus Professor of Ancient Philosophy and Science at the University of Cambridge.
